#BFDFEE Hex color

#BFDFEE

The hexadecimal color code #BFDFEE corresponds to the code RGB( 191, 223, 238 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,75 level), green (at 0,87 level) and blue (at 0,93 level). Its brightness is 84% and its saturation is 58%. It is composed of red at 29%, green at 34% and blue at 36%.
